- garg.shobhit1 June 23, 2011Maximum 14 throws are required.
Method:
x x+(x-1) x+(x-1)+(x-2)........100
nth term of this series nx-(1+2+3.....till(n-1))
=nx-(n)(n-1)/2
{nx-n(n-1)/2}>=100
for any value of n [1,2,3,4.....]
min value of x which satisfy the equation is 14.
so the answer is 14.
